GEMS Wellington International School ( Arabic: مدرسة جیمس ولینغتون انترناسیونال) is a private school situated in the Al Sufouh area of Dubai in the United Arab Emirates. The school has over 3000 students enrolled over all age groups.

    In 1976, the United Arab Emirates University (UAEU) was established in Al Ain in Abu Dhabi Emirate. Consisting of nine colleges, it was considered by the UAE government to be the leading teaching and research institution in the country. More than 14,000 students were enrolled at UAEU in the first semester of the academic year 2006–7.

    The British and Indian curricula alone account for 64% of all enrollment in Dubai-based private schools. [7] Tuition at these private schools range from AED 1,725 to AED 107,200 per year, [8] and Dubai's annual revenue from private schooling fees is AED 5.35bn. 39% of students pay less than AED 10,000 in tuition per year.
